The fourth set of bookes : vvherein are anthemes for versus and chorus, madrigals, and songs of other kindes, to 4. 5. and 6. parts: apt both for viols and voyces. Newly composed by Michaell East, Batchelor of Musicke, and Master of the choristers in the Cathedrall Church of Litchfield.

- London : Printed by Thomas Snodham, for Matthew Lownes and Iohn Browne, 1618.
- Notes:
- Six partbooks. At head of title, part 1: "Cantus."; part 2: "Altus."; part 3: "Tenor."; part 4: "Bassus."; part 5: "Quintus."; part 6: "Sextus.".
- At foot of title page: Cum priuilegio.
- A variant of the edition with 1619 in the imprint (STC 7464).
- Signatures: [A]2 B-D4; C-D4; [A]2 B-D4; [A]2 B-D4; [C]2 D4; [A]2 B-D4.
- Reproduction of the original in the Christ Church (University of Oxford). Library.
